| molecularNote | Transgenic mice were generated from a BAC in which exon 1 of the Foxn4 locus had been replaced with the coding sequence of codon-improved cre (icre) by homologou recombination. An frt-flanked selection cassette (kanamycin-resistance gene driven by the prokaryotic EM7 promoter) followed the icre sequence and was excised by Flp-recombination in bacteria during recombineering. Three founder lines were generated by pronuclear injection of the final 150 kb construct, with the line providing the most robust combination was selected for further study. No line numbers were specified in the reference. |
